ORANGE, Calif. -- Willamette University goalkeeper Sam Borngasser (Jr., GK, Grants Pass, OR/Grants Pass HS) earned eight saves, but Chapman University scored early in each half to defeat the Bearcats, 2-0, on Friday, Sept. 1 at Wilson Field. It was the season opener for both teams, as Chapman grabbed a 1-0 record and Willamette fell to 0-1.

Both of Chapman's goals were scored off a corner kick. Emma Harper registered the opening goal 2:15 into the game. She scored on a header from eight yards out after Chaslyn Nestor took the game's first corner kick. Harper was near the far post for her header, which she sent into the middle of the goal.

The Panthers doubled their lead less than five minutes into the second half at 49:47. Pilar Vanheusden scored on a shot from just inside the penalty area after a corner kick from Nestor was deflected.

Chapman outshot Willamette 23-5 and held a 13-3 margin in shots on target, but the Bearcats kept the Panthers off the scoreboard for the final 40 minutes in each half. Chapman finished with five corner kicks, while Willamette earned two corner kicks. Vanhousden led all players with four total shots, as she placed all four shots on goal. Ella Abraham (Jr., F, Lexington, KY/Lafayette HS) led WU with two shots, including one shot on goal.

Borngasser played the first 72:40 in goal for Willamette. Siera Edwards (So., GK, Portland, OR/Sunset HS) played the final 17:20 in the nets and provided WU with three saves. Aaliyah Bustamante played all 90 minutes for the Panthers and recorded three saves.
